Overview
P4SMA51CAHE3/5A from Vishay General Semiconductor is a bidirectional surface-mount Transient Voltage Suppressor (TVS) diode in SMA (DO-214AC) package, designed for clamping voltage transients on signal and power lines. It features a 51 V breakdown voltage (VBR min/max = 48.5–53.6 V at 1 mA), 400 W peak pulse power (10/1000 µs), and clamps to ≤70.1 V at 5.7 A peak pulse current - used in automotive sensor protection, industrial I/O interfaces, and telecom line surge suppression.
For engineers reviewing the P4SMA51CAHE3/5A datasheet, P4SMA51CAHE3/5A pinout, P4SMA51CAHE3/5A application, or P4SMA51CAHE3/5A equivalent, this page delivers verified electrical specs, AEC-Q101 qualification status, thermal resistance (RθJA = 120 °C/W), clamping behavior under transient stress, and direct alternatives with documented parameter differences.
Technical Context
This bidirectional TVS operates symmetrically across both polarities, with identical VBR, VC, and IPPM in either direction. Its glass-passivated junction ensures stable avalanche characteristics and low leakage (<1 µA at 43.6 V stand-off).
Designed for automated SMT assembly, it meets J-STD-020 MSL Level 1 (peak reflow 260 °C) and supports repetitive surge duty cycles up to 0.01% - delivering 400 W pulse capability below 91 V and 300 W above that threshold per derating curve.

FAQ
What does the "CA" suffix mean in P4SMA51CAHE3/5A?
The "CA" suffix indicates a bidirectional configuration: the device provides symmetrical transient suppression in both polarities, with identical breakdown and clamping characteristics regardless of voltage polarity. This makes P4SMA51CAHE3/5A ideal for protecting AC-coupled signals, differential buses like RS-485, or floating sensor outputs where polarity reversal may occur during transients.
Is P4SMA51CAHE3/5A qualified for automotive use?
Yes, P4SMA51CAHE3/5A carries the HE3 suffix, denoting RoHS-compliant construction and full AEC-Q101 qualification. It has passed stress tests including temperature cycling, high-temperature reverse bias (HTRB), and ESD per JESD22-A114 - confirming suitability for under-hood and body-control module applications per automotive OEM requirements.
What is the maximum clamping voltage of P4SMA51CAHE3/5A under surge conditions?
The maximum clamping voltage (VC) of P4SMA51CAHE3/5A is 70.1 V at 5.7 A peak pulse current (IPPM) under the standard 10/1000 µs waveform. This value is measured after the device enters avalanche conduction and represents the upper voltage limit imposed on protected circuitry during a defined transient event.
How does the SMA (DO-214AC) package of P4SMA51CAHE3/5A compare to SMB or SMC packages?
The SMA package of P4SMA51CAHE3/5A measures 4.3 × 2.6 mm with a 2.54 mm lead pitch - smaller than SMB (DO-214AA, 4.6 × 3.9 mm) and significantly smaller than SMC (DO-214AB, 7.1 × 6.2 mm). While its RθJA is 120 °C/W (higher than SMB's 80 °C/W), the SMA footprint enables dense routing in space-constrained layouts typical in automotive ECUs and portable telecom gear.
Can P4SMA51CAHE3/5A be used in place of a unidirectional TVS like P4SMA51A?
No - P4SMA51CAHE3/5A is strictly bidirectional and lacks polarity marking, whereas P4SMA51A is unidirectional with cathode band identification. Substituting them requires verifying circuit topology: P4SMA51CAHE3/5A suits floating or AC-coupled lines; P4SMA51A is mandatory for DC-biased lines where reverse conduction must be blocked. Interchange alters clamping behavior and may compromise protection.
